Game Over.
Collingwood 11.13 79
Sydney 6.14 50
Worst performance by the Swans this year. Apart from that burst early in the 4th quarter, the Swans had no momentum in the midfield and the run from the backline was absent at times. Kicking for goal was ordinary, likewise disposal in the backline.
Kirk was best on ground for Sydney, Jolly was pretty good along with Mattner. There were a lot of ordinary performances eg. Malceski, ROK, MOL, Barry, McVeigh, Bevan, Buchanan, etc.
Hall was yet again beaten by Wakelin (who had 22 disposal), with Bazza kicking 1.3 and conceding 5 free kicks. He might come under scrutiny by the MRP for an attempted swing against Wakelin.
Next week against the Hawks, there'll be several changes to the team lineup with Goodes returning. B2 will have to be a lot better to take on Buddy and I can't imagine what will happen if Leo is up against Roughead.
